Write 2 3/5 as an improper fraction
2 answers:
2 3/5 as an improper fraction would be 13/5
In order to get that you first multiply the whole number (2) by the denominator (5) and get 10
Then you add the numerator (3) to the number you just got (10) which is 13 and that becomes your numerator and you keep 5 as your denominator.

Multiply the denominator by the whole and add to the numerator
